ホームページ >ウェブフロントエンド >jsチュートリアル >JavaScriptでページジャンプを制御する方法
方法: 1. "window.location.href="ページ アドレス"" を使用します。 2. "window.history.back()" ステートメントを使用します。 3. "window.navigate()" を使用します。ステートメント; 4. 「self.location="address"」ステートメントを使用します。
このチュートリアルの動作環境: Windows7 システム、JavaScript バージョン 1.8.5、Dell G3 コンピューター。
最初の方法: 直接ジャンプしてパラメータを追加
<script language="javascript" type="text/javascript"> window.location.href="login.jsp?backurl="+window.location.href; </script>
directly Jumpパラメータなし:
<script>window.location.href='http://www.baidu.com';</script>
2 番目: 最後のプレビュー インターフェイスに戻る
<script language="javascript"> alert("返回"); window.history.back(-1); </script>
タグのネスト:
<a href="javascript:history.go(-1)">返回上一步</a> <a href="<%=Request.ServerVariables("HTTP_REFERER")%>">返回上一步</a>
3 番目のタイプ: 指定されたジャンプページはフレームに対して無効です。 。 。
<script language="javascript"> window.navigate("top.jsp"); </script>
4 番目の方法: 独自のジャンプ ページの指定は、フレームに対して無効です。 。
<script language="JavaScript"> self.location='top.htm'; </script>
アプリケーション例:
<head> <script language="javascript"> function old_page() { window.location = "login.aspx" } function replace() { window.location.replace("login.aspx") } function new_page() { window.open("login.aspx") } </script> </head> <body> <input type="button" onclick="new_page()" value="在新窗口打开s"/> <input type="button" onclick="old_page()" value="跳转后有后退功能"/> <input type="button" onclick="replace()" value="跳转后没有后退功能"/> </body>
プログラミング関連の知識の詳細については、プログラミング ビデオをご覧ください。 !
以上がJavaScriptでページジャンプを制御する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。